7009 ACE/HCP4AH1DGA Bearing Product Overview & Core Advantages

The 7009 ACE/HCP4AH1DGA is a high-precision angular contact ball bearing engineered for demanding applications requiring exceptional accuracy and performance. This P4A tolerance class bearing features a universal matchable (SU) design, allowing two bearings to be paired for optimal performance. Its core advantages include the ability to handle combined loads (radial and axial) efficiently, superior high-speed capabilities with a limiting speed of 46,000 rpm, and outstanding rigidity due to its specific design and ceramic ball construction. It is pre-lubricated and operates within a wide temperature range, making it a reliable, high-performance solution for precision machinery.

7009 ACE/HCP4AH1DGA Bearing Model Code Explained, Specifications & Naming Convention

Code Segment Technical Meaning
7009 Basic bearing series and size designation (45mm bore, 75mm OD).
ACE Indicates a 25° contact angle and specific internal design optimizations.
HC Signifies the use of Hybrid Ceramic balls for enhanced speed and durability.
P4A Denotes an ultra-high precision tolerance class, superior to ABEC 7.
H1 Specifies an extra light preload (Class A) for minimal friction and high-speed operation.
DGA Indicates a universal matchable (SU) arrangement, where two bearings can be paired face-to-face or back-to-back.

7009 ACE/HCP4AH1DGA Bearing Structural Features & Performance Benefits

Hybrid Ceramic Construction: The combination of chrome steel rings and ceramic balls (Si3N4) significantly reduces centrifugal forces, lowers operating temperature, and extends service life, enabling superior high-speed performance.

Phenolic Resin Cage: The lightweight and robust phenolic cage ensures excellent dimensional stability and guidance at high rotational speeds, contributing to the bearing's high limiting speed.

25° Contact Angle & Universal Matchability: The 25° contact angle provides an optimal balance between radial and axial load capacity. The universal matchable (SU) design allows for simple and precise arrangement of two bearings to withstand combined loads and moments, enhancing system rigidity.

P4A Precision & Extra Light Preload: Manufactured to P4A tolerance class, this bearing ensures minimal runout and vibration for ultra-precise applications. The extra light preload (H1) minimizes starting and running torque, making it ideal for high-speed spindles.

7009 ACE/HCP4AH1DGA Bearing Typical Application Areas

This high-precision angular contact ball bearing is ideally suited for applications demanding maximum speed, accuracy, and rigidity, including:

  • Machine Tool Spindles: High-speed milling, grinding, and turning centers.
  • Precision Robotics: Arm joints and high-accuracy positioning systems.
  • High-Frequency Motors & Spindles: Where extreme rotational speeds are required.
  • Aerospace & Defense Systems: Gyroscopes, radar systems, and other precision instruments.
  • Medical Equipment: Dental handpieces and high-speed surgical tools.
